Maintenance Planning for Continuous Operation

The 2198-DB80-F bus bar does not operate in isolation. It is the physical and electrical backbone that links multiple Kinetix 5700 drive modules on a shared DC bus architecture. When planning a replacement or conducting a control cabinet inspection, maintenance engineers should treat this component as part of a broader system health review. A failed or degraded bus bar often indicates thermal stress or overcurrent events that may have affected adjacent components.

Begin by verifying the condition of the 2198-P208 or 2198-P070 Kinetix 5700 AC/DC converter module — the upstream power source feeding the shared bus. A converter module that has experienced internal faults may have subjected the bus bar to voltage spikes beyond its rated envelope. Simultaneously, inspect the 2198-D006-ERS3 or 2198-D032-ERS3 dual-axis servo drive modules connected on either side of the bus bar; their internal bus capacitors and gate driver boards are susceptible to the same thermal events that degrade the bus bar itself.

On the I/O and control side, check the 1756-IB16 or 1756-OB16 ControlLogix digital I/O modules that interface with the motion controller. Intermittent drive faults caused by a failing bus bar can generate spurious I/O state changes that may have triggered protective logic or latched fault codes in the PLC program. Review the 1756-L85E ControlLogix controller fault log and clear any latched drive-related faults after the bus bar replacement is confirmed.

Communication integrity should also be verified. The Kinetix 5700 system communicates over EtherNet/IP using the 2198-CAPMOD-2240 capacitor module and the drive’s integrated network port. Confirm that the 1783-US8T Stratix managed switch or equivalent EtherNet/IP infrastructure switch shows no port errors on the drive network segment after restoration. A bus fault event can cause momentary network dropouts that leave switch port counters in an error state.

For facilities using a 2198-TCON-24V24 or similar terminal block and connector kit, inspect all power and feedback wiring terminations at the drive connectors. High-current bus events can loosen crimped terminals and degrade insulation on motor feedback cables. Replace any 2090-XXNFMF-Sxx servo motor feedback cables showing insulation cracking or connector pin corrosion.

If the control cabinet includes a 1492-AIFM8-F-5 analog interface module or signal isolators for process feedback loops, verify their supply rail integrity — shared DC bus disturbances can propagate into 24 V DC auxiliary supplies and affect analog signal accuracy. Finally, confirm that the cabinet’s 1606-XLP power supply or equivalent 24 V DC SMPS is within voltage tolerance before returning the system to automatic mode.

Building a minimum viable spare parts kit around the 2198-DB80-F for a Kinetix 5700 installation should include at least one spare bus bar, one spare converter module fuse set, one set of drive module connector kits, and a replacement feedback cable for the highest-cycle axis. This kit approach reduces mean time to repair (MTTR) from hours to minutes during an emergency callout.

Site Replacement Workflow

Step 1 — Isolate and de-energize. Open the main disconnect and verify zero voltage on the DC bus using a calibrated meter before touching any bus bar connection. Kinetix 5700 bus capacitors retain charge for several minutes after power removal; always wait for the drive’s CHARGE indicator to extinguish.

Step 2 — Document existing configuration. Photograph the bus bar orientation, cable routing, and any axis-specific parameter labels before disassembly. Capture the drive node addresses and EtherNet/IP IP assignments from the Logix Designer project if not already documented.

Step 3 — Remove the failed 2198-DB80-F. Loosen the bus bar retaining fasteners in the sequence specified in Rockwell publication 2198-UM002. Avoid applying lateral force to adjacent drive module housings.

Step 4 — Install the replacement unit. Seat the new 2198-DB80-F fully before tightening fasteners to the specified torque (refer to the installation manual for current torque values). Verify that the bus bar contacts are fully engaged with both adjacent drive modules.

Step 5 — Restore and verify. Re-energize in stages: apply control power first, confirm no fault codes, then apply bus power. Use Logix Designer or Studio 5000 to run a drive self-test on each axis before returning to automatic production mode. Log the replacement date and component serial number in the site CMMS for warranty tracking.

This workflow is compatible with both new installations and legacy Kinetix 5700 systems that may have been in service for five or more years. The 2198-DB80-F is a direct form-fit-function replacement for the original factory-installed bus bar, requiring no firmware changes or parameter re-commissioning.
